WebHistory of Wawa Inc. With 550 outlets in 2006, Wawa Inc. is one of the largest privately held convenience store chains in the United States. ... 1964 Grahame Wood, Jr., opens the first Wawa Food Market in Folsom, Pennsylvania. 1968 Wawa Dairy Farms and Wawa Food Markets merge with the Millville Manufacturing Co. to form Wawa Inc. 1977 Wawa ...
